Wraith: The Oblivion - Afterlife offers a deep, narrative-driven experience in a dark fantasy setting, encouraging critical thinking and empathy by exploring the human condition from a monster's perspective. As a VR title, it provides strong spatial awareness, hand-eye coordination, and physical activity benefits.

The game's M rating and 'World of Darkness' setting indicate notable levels of violence and fear/horror content. While free from manipulative monetization or social risks, parents should be aware of the mature themes.
